Defense Minister receives his Turkish Counterpart in Istanbul
[26/07/2023 06:25]
ISTANBUL-SABA
Minister of Defense General Lieutenant Mohsen al-Da'iri met Wednesday here with his counterpart Yasar Guler discussing with him cooperation between the two countries in training and qualification fields.
Al-Dai'ri pointed out to deep-rooted historical relations between the two countries, praising great improvements in military industry in Turkey and what he saw in IDFE Show for defense industries.
He pointed out to the nature of conditions in Yemen under Houthi terrorist militia's stubbornness and rejection to international efforts for realizing peace, pointing out to the militia's danger on the international navigation and international trade way.
For his part, Turkish defense minister welcomed General al-Da'iri, praising Yemeni-Turkish relations and hoped regaining security, stability and peace in Yemen.
